Comparing the Intravenous Treatment of Skin Infections in Children, Home Versus Hospital
NCT02334124 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 190
Last updated 2022-11-08
Summary
Many children every year present to the Emergency Department (ED) at The Royal Children's Hospital (RCH) with cellulitis (skin infection). If it is mild, the children can go home with oral antibiotic treatment. If it is complicated and severe, these children are admitted to hospital for intravenous (IV, through a drip) antibiotic treatment. There is a middle group with uncomplicated moderate/severe cellulitis who require IV antibiotics but who are not acutely unwell. In order to determine whether it is just as effective for children with uncomplicated moderate to severe cellulitis to receive antibiotic treatment at home (via Hospital-In-The-Home) as it is to receive antibiotic treatment in hospital, there is a need to conduct a larger study and randomly assign children to receive either HITH or hospital ward care.
The primary research question to be addressed is:
In children with moderate/severe uncomplicated cellulitis, is the failure rate at 2 days following the first dose of antibiotic non-inferior for children treated with IV antibiotics at home compared to the failure rate at 2 days following the first dose for children treated with IV antibiotics in hospital?

Home
The main intervention is for children with uncomplicated cellulitis to remain at home throughout the period of intravenous treatment but as it is not feasible to administer flucloxacillin four times a day by the Hospital-In-The-Home team, once daily ceftriaxone is the most ideal antibiotic to be given to this group
